Friday, July 30, 1948, page 2
Edward W. Ashmann, 43, an employe of the Altite Motor Parts Co., died Wednesday in Mary Washington Hospital. He was a former resident of Chatsworth, Ill. and was a veteran of eight years service in the Marine Corps.
Surviving are his wife, Mrs. Ellen Crow Ashmann; a daughter, Gloria Dean Ashmann; four brothers, George Ashmann, Streator, Ill.; Robert Ashmann, Cullom, Ill.; and Arnold and Richard Ashmann, both of Chatsworth; and a sister, Mrs. Charles Ellis, Chicago, Ill.
Funeral rites will be held Sunday at 2 p.m. at the Church of God, conducted by the Rev. A. G. Littek, with burial in Oak Hill Cemetery.
Pallbearers will be J. D. Wilson, Earnest Neblin, Russell Noland, John Hall, Clarence Atkins and Charles Sullivan.
